Grant Major was born in 1955 in Palmerston North, Manawatu, New Zealand. He is a production designer and art director, known for King Kong (2005), The Lord of the Rings: The Fellowship of the Ring (2001) and The Lord of the Rings: The Return of the King (2003).

Jun 21, 2014 · Grant Major ( 1955) was the production designer for The Lord of the Rings (film series). He oversaw the creation of sets such as Rivendell, Hobbiton, Moria, and others.
